Koi island
About Koi island
Koi Island is a short boat ride away and features a sloping wall reef that supports drift diving. The reef runs from shallow water down to deeper sections. Divers can encounter sharks and large schools of fish along the wall.

Reported Depth
5m - 40m
Depth Note
Reef reported to start around 5 m and extend to about 40 m.
Typical Conditions
Drift dive along a sloping wall reef.

Key Hazards
Safety Notes
This is described as a drift dive with sharks present; plan for current management and maintain appropriate distance from wildlife.
